Abstract
SUMMARY: Enterobacteria are more resistant to nalidixic acid than the majority of other Gram-negative organisms isolated from river water, so allowing their selection on MacConkey agar containing nalidixic acid. Selection is further improved by anaerobic incubation which, with nalidixic acid, virtually eliminates oxidase-positive strains such asPseudomonasorAeromonas.This publication has 6 references indexed in Scilit:
